ResumoWe evaluate $B\to K\pi$ decay amplitudes in perturbative QCD picture. It is found that penguin contributions are dynamically enhanced by nearly 50% compared to those assumed in the factorization approximation. It is also shown that annihilation diagrams are not negligible, and give large strong phases. Our results for branching ratios of $B\to K\pi$ decays for a representative parameter set are consistent with data. We evaluate $B\to K\pi$ decay amplitudes in perturbative QCD picture.
